Australia — Marriage

Not eligible

A person can sponsor a partner for an Australian visa twice in their lifetime, and on what you have described your partner has used both. That closes the partner visa route through them, and it does not reopen with time in the way the five-year rule does.

There is one way past it, and it is discretionary. The limitation can be waived where there are compelling circumstances, and the cases that succeed tend to involve something that makes the limit produce an obviously unjust outcome — children of the current relationship, the death of a previous partner, or previous relationships that ended through no fault of your partner's. It is worth putting in front of someone who can assess the actual history rather than treating the limit as the final word, because the threshold is about the circumstances rather than the number.

If no waiver is available, the route into Australia has to come from your side rather than your partner's. Points-tested skilled migration and employer sponsorship are assessed on occupation, age, English and work experience and are unaffected by your partner's sponsorship history. If you qualify on those terms, your partner's status in Australia becomes an advantage in the application rather than the basis of it.
